Why You Should Hire a Birth Injury Attorney

A skilled attorney for birth injuries will quickly collect and effectively present key evidence. They will bring in medical experts who will carefully review the records and offer their opinions on what went wrong.

The plaintiffs in a birth injury claim must establish that healthcare providers did not adhere to the standards of medical treatment and that negligence was directly responsible for the child's injuries. Parents may seek compensation for future and past medical expenses and lost income, as well as suffering and pain and damages.

Medical Negligence

Each year, many newborns are injured during the birth process due to medical negligence. These injuries can have long-term and life-altering consequences for families, resulting in significant medical expenses and loss of income. If you suspect that medical negligence resulted in a birth-related accident, it is crucial to speak with an Pasadena Birth Injury Attorney as soon as possible. A skilled lawyer can assist you to understand your legal options and seek the compensation you deserve.

Medical negligence claims may involve any kind of injury suffered by a mother and/or her child due to the negligence of a healthcare professional. In general, to prove medical negligence in a birth injury claim the plaintiff needs to establish two elements: breaching of duty of care and causation. In order for medical professionals to violate their duty of care and to be found guilty, they must have departed from the standard of care that a healthcare professional would have given in similar circumstances.

A birth injury lawyer will review your child's medical records to determine if any medical negligence occurred during delivery. They can then work with medical professionals to ensure that all evidence is collected and analyzed properly prior to its use in your case. Additionally an attorney for medical malpractice can assist with preparing your birth injury lawsuit to ensure you receive the maximum amount of compensation.

Medical negligence may include excessive force used by an individual doctor, the incorrect use of surgical equipment or tools as well as the failure to perform a c-section when it is required, and many other examples. A Pasadena birth injury lawyer can assist you in reviewing your medical records and determine if there is any doubt regarding the carelessness of a healthcare professional.

It is not always the obstetrician that is accountable for birth injuries. Other healthcare professionals, such as the anesthesiologist and hospital staff could be liable as well. An experienced birth injury lawyer can help you identify the parties who could be accountable for the injuries and seek damages against them. The financial compensation that you receive will be used to pay for immediate expenses and long-term costs and also non-economic damages related to your child's birth injury.

Birth Injuries

Birth injuries can be a major issue that could have a lasting impact on the child and their family. These injuries may include cerebral palsy as well as developmental delays. These complications often result from a deficiency of oxygen in the first few days after the birth. Many of these injuries would have been preventable with proper medical care and timely medical intervention.

These newborns may need medical therapy, physical therapy, or adaptive equipment. This can include walking aids, wheelchairs or even surgical equipment to help with breathing and other activities. Parents can be burdened with a lifetime of medical expenses and that's why it's important to consider making a legal claim with the assistance of a qualified lawyer.

Medical negligence shouldn't be tolerated, whether a child suffered an injury during the birth process or due to complications during prenatal care. The best method to determine whether your family is legally entitled to compensation is to meet with a seasoned California birth injury lawyer.

There are many elements to be able to prove the medical malpractice lawsuit, including proving that a doctor violated the standard of care during pregnancy and birth. The standard of care refers to the behavior that is expected of an expert in medicine who has similar training and experience in similar circumstances.

A lawyer can assist to identify this by reviewing medical records and analysing the facts of the situation. They can to determine the cause of the injury. This could involve analyzing the results of tests or talking to witnesses. In a case of birth injury the responsible parties could include doctors, nurses and other healthcare professionals as well as the hospital or facility, and third-party providers, such the makers of medical equipment used during delivery.
